Error eperm Operation not permitted open — что делать

Ошибка Error eperm Operation not permitted open возникает, когда операционная система не разрешает доступ к файлу или директории. Эта ошибка может возникать по разным причинам, включая недостаточные права доступа или блокировку файла другим процессом.

В следующих разделах статьи мы рассмотрим несколько возможных решений для исправления ошибки Error eperm Operation not permitted open. Мы расскажем о проверке прав доступа к файлу или директории, о разблокировке файлов, а также о том, как обратиться к администратору системы, если у вас нет прав на доступ к файлу. Если вы столкнулись с этой ошибкой, продолжайте чтение, чтобы найти решение проблемы и восстановить доступ к вашим файлам.

Ошибка eperm: операция не разрешена, открыть что делать

Ошибка eperm: операция не разрешена (EPERM: operation not permitted) может возникать при выполнении различных операций на файловой системе или приложении, когда у пользователя отсутствуют необходимые права доступа. Эта ошибка сообщает о том, что текущий пользователь не имеет разрешения на выполнение определенной операции.

Чтобы исправить данную ошибку, следует выполнить несколько шагов:

1. Проверьте права доступа к файлу или каталогу

Первым шагом при возникновении ошибки eperm необходимо проверить права доступа к файлу или каталогу, на который вы пытаетесь выполнить операцию. Убедитесь, что у вас есть достаточные права на чтение, запись или выполнение данного файла или каталога.

2. Войдите в систему с учетными данными с административными правами

Если у вас нет необходимых прав на выполнение операции, можно попытаться войти в систему с учетными данными, которые обладают административными правами. Это может позволить вам выполнить операцию, которую вы не могли выполнить ранее.

3. Измените права доступа к файлу или каталогу

Если вы владелец файла или каталога, вы можете изменить его права доступа с помощью команды chmod в командной строке. Например, следующая команда изменит права доступа для пользователя на чтение и запись: chmod u+rw filename.

4. Обратитесь к администратору системы

Если вы не можете изменить права доступа к файлу или каталогу или у вас нет возможности войти в систему с административными правами, рекомендуется обратиться к администратору системы. Администратор сможет проверить и исправить проблемы с правами доступа к файловой системе или приложению.

Error: EPERM: operation not permitted, rename [solved], Windows

Понимание ошибки EPERM

Ошибка EPERM (Operation not permitted) является одной из наиболее распространенных ошибок, с которыми сталкиваются разработчики при работе с файловой системой в операционных системах Linux и Unix. Эта ошибка указывает на то, что операция, которую вы пытаетесь выполнить, не разрешена или неправильно настроена для вашего пользователя или процесса.

Возможные причины ошибки EPERM

Существует несколько возможных причин возникновения ошибки EPERM:

  • Недостаточные права доступа: Возможно, у вашего пользователя или процесса недостаточно прав доступа для выполнения требуемой операции. Например, попытка создания файла в защищенной директории или изменения системного файла без соответствующих привилегий.

  • Заблокированный файл: Если файл, с которым вы пытаетесь работать, уже заблокирован другим процессом или программой, возникает ошибка EPERM. В этом случае вам нужно убедиться, что файл не используется другими процессами и освободить его или изменить права доступа.

  • Неправильные настройки безопасности: Иногда ошибка EPERM может возникать из-за неправильных настроек безопасности операционной системы, которые не позволяют вашему пользователю или процессу выполнять определенные операции. В этом случае вам придется изменить настройки безопасности или обратиться к системному администратору.

Как исправить ошибку EPERM

Чтобы исправить ошибку EPERM, вы можете попробовать следующие решения:

  1. Проверьте права доступа: Убедитесь, что у вашего пользователя или процесса достаточно прав доступа для выполнения операции. Если нет, вы можете изменить права доступа с помощью команды chmod или обратиться к системному администратору для получения необходимых прав.
  2. Проверьте блокировку файла: Убедитесь, что файл, с которым вы работаете, не блокируется другими процессами или программами. Если файл заблокирован, вы можете попытаться завершить связанные процессы или программы, которые его используют, и повторить операцию.

  3. Измените настройки безопасности: Если причина ошибки EPERM связана с настройками безопасности операционной системы, вам может потребоваться изменить эти настройки. Для этого вам понадобятся административные привилегии или помощь системного администратора.

В случае, если ни одно из вышеперечисленных решений не помогло, вы можете обратиться за помощью к сообществу разработчиков или обратиться к документации по вашей операционной системе. Важно помнить, что ошибка EPERM является индикатором неправильной конфигурации или ограничений на уровне операционной системы, которые могут потребовать дальнейшего расследования и изменения настроек.

Причины ошибки eperm

Ошибка «eperm» (Operation not permitted) может возникнуть в различных ситуациях, когда операционная система не разрешает выполнение определенной операции. Рассмотрим некоторые из наиболее распространенных причин данной ошибки:

1. Недостаточные права доступа

Одним из основных и наиболее распространенных причин ошибки eperm является отсутствие у пользователя прав доступа для выполнения операции. Операционная система защищает определенные файлы и директории от изменений и требует соответствующих привилегий для их выполнения. Если у пользователя нет необходимых прав доступа, то возникает ошибка eperm.

2. Занятые ресурсы

В некоторых случаях, операционная система может выдавать ошибку eperm, если ресурс, с которым пытается работать программа, уже используется другим процессом или приложением. Это может произойти, например, при попытке записи в файл, который уже открыт на чтение другим процессом.

3. Ограничения безопасности

Некоторые операционные системы имеют встроенные ограничения безопасности, которые запрещают выполнение определенных операций. Это может быть связано с повышенным уровнем защиты, настроенным в системе или политиками безопасности, установленными администратором. В таких случаях, ошибка eperm может возникать при попытке выполнить некоторые операции, даже если у пользователя есть необходимые права доступа.

4. Неправильные параметры

Иногда, ошибка eperm может возникать из-за неправильно указанных параметров при выполнении операции. Например, если указан неверный путь к файлу или директории, то операционная система может выдать ошибку eperm.

Как правило, чтобы исправить ошибку eperm, необходимо получить соответствующие права доступа от администратора системы или изменить параметры операции, чтобы они соответствовали требованиям операционной системы. В некоторых случаях, может потребоваться изменение политик безопасности или освобождение занятых ресурсов.

Решение ошибки EPERM

Ошибка EPERM (Operation not permitted) может возникать при выполнении различных операций на компьютере или сервере. Эта ошибка обычно указывает на то, что у пользователя нет прав на выполнение требуемой операции.

Чтобы решить ошибку EPERM, следует выполнить следующие действия:

1. Проверить права доступа

Первым шагом необходимо проверить, что у пользователя есть достаточные права доступа для выполнения требуемой операции. Для этого можно использовать команду ls -l в командной строке для просмотра прав доступа к файлам и папкам.

2. Изменить права доступа

Если права доступа недостаточны, их можно изменить с помощью команды chmod в командной строке. Например, чтобы предоставить права на выполнение файла, можно использовать команду chmod +x filename. Обратите внимание, что изменение прав доступа может быть опасно, поэтому перед выполнением этой операции рекомендуется ознакомиться с документацией.

3. Запустить программу с правами администратора

Если у пользователя нет достаточных прав для выполнения операции, можно попробовать запустить программу с правами администратора. Для этого можно щелкнуть правой кнопкой мыши на исполняемом файле или ярлыке программы и выбрать пункт «Запустить от имени администратора» в контекстном меню.

4. Проверить наличие конфликтующих программ или процессов

Иногда ошибка EPERM может быть вызвана конфликтом с другими программами или процессами, которые блокируют доступ к файлу или ресурсу. В этом случае рекомендуется закрыть все ненужные программы или процессы и повторить операцию.

5. Обратиться за помощью к администратору системы

Если проблема не удается решить самостоятельно, рекомендуется обратиться за помощью к администратору системы или технической поддержке. Они смогут провести более детальную диагностику и предложить решение проблемы в конкретной ситуации.

Дополнительные рекомендации

Если вы столкнулись с ошибкой Error: EPERM: operation not permitted, open, и предыдущие решения не помогли решить проблему, вот несколько дополнительных рекомендаций, которые могут быть полезны.

1. Проверьте разрешения доступа к файлам и папкам

Убедитесь, что у вас есть права на чтение, запись и исполнение для файлов и папок, с которыми вы работаете. Если разрешения неверны, вы можете получить ошибку EPERM. Чтобы изменить разрешения, вы можете использовать команду chmod в терминале или щелкнуть правой кнопкой мыши на файле/папке и выбрать «Свойства» или «Изменить разрешения».

2. Проверьте наличие других программ или процессов, которые могут блокировать доступ

Если файл или папка, с которыми вы работаете, используется другим процессом или программой, это может вызвать ошибку EPERM. Проверьте, есть ли запущенные программы, которые могут иметь доступ к файлу или папке, и закройте их, прежде чем продолжить работу.

3. Отключите антивирусное программное обеспечение

В некоторых случаях антивирусное программное обеспечение может блокировать доступ к определенным файлам или папкам и вызывать ошибку EPERM. Попробуйте отключить свое антивирусное программное обеспечение временно и проверить, решит ли это проблему. Если это помогает, вы можете попробовать настроить свое антивирусное программное обеспечение, чтобы оно не блокировало доступ к нужным файлам и папкам.

4. Проверьте логи системы

Если все вышеперечисленные рекомендации не помогли, вы можете проверить логи системы, чтобы узнать больше информации о том, что может вызывать ошибку EPERM. Зайдите в журналы системы и поищите записи, связанные с этой ошибкой. Это может дать вам больше информации о причине ошибки и помочь вам найти решение.

Запрос помощи у специалистов

Когда вы сталкиваетесь с ошибкой «Error eperm Operation not permitted open», это может быть сигналом о том, что вам нужна помощь специалиста для решения проблемы. В таких случаях рекомендуется обратиться к профессионалам, которые имеют опыт в работе с данной проблемой.

Что же делать, если вы столкнулись с ошибкой «Error eperm Operation not permitted open»? В первую очередь, вы можете обратиться к документации, связанной с программным обеспечением или операционной системой, с которой возникла проблема. В документации вы можете найти информацию о причинах ошибки и возможных способах ее устранения. Однако, если вы не уверены в своих навыках или не можете найти подходящее решение, то лучше обратиться к специалисту.

Почему обратиться к специалисту?

Специалисты имеют глубокие знания и опыт в работе с различными технологиями и проблемами. Они могут быстро оценить ситуацию, найти причину проблемы и предложить эффективное решение. Более того, специалисты могут помочь вам избежать дополнительных ошибок или проблем, которые могут возникнуть при неправильном решении проблемы.

Как выбрать специалиста?

При выборе специалиста, вам следует обратить внимание на его опыт работы с аналогичными проблемами, сертификаты и рекомендации от других клиентов. Наиболее эффективным способом поиска специалиста является обращение к проверенным и надежным IT-компаниям или студиям, которые специализируются на решении проблем с программным обеспечением и операционными системами.

Кроме того, вы можете также обратиться за помощью к сообществам и форумам, где эксперты и другие пользователи могут поделиться своим опытом и решением проблемы. Однако, учитывайте, что полученная информация может быть непроверенной и не всегда действенной.

Профилактика ошибки eperm

Ошибка eperm (Operation not permitted) может возникать при выполнении операций, когда пользователь не имеет достаточных прав доступа к файлам или директориям. Чтобы избежать данной ошибки, рекомендуется принять следующие меры:

1. Проверьте права доступа к файлам и директориям

Убедитесь, что у вас есть достаточные права доступа к файлам и директориям, с которыми вы работаете. Можно использовать команду ls -l для вывода информации о правах доступа к файлам и директориям, а также команду chmod для изменения прав доступа, если это необходимо.

2. Измените владельца и группу файлов

Если у вас нет прав доступа к файлам, вы можете изменить владельца и группу файлов на те, которые соответствуют вашему пользователю и группе. Используйте команду chown для изменения владельца и команду chgrp для изменения группы.

3. Запустите программу с правами суперпользователя

В случае, если вам не удается выполнить операцию с текущими правами доступа, можно попробовать запустить программу с правами суперпользователя, используя команду sudo или войти в систему под учетной записью суперпользователя с помощью команды su.

4. Проверьте ограничения SELinux или AppArmor

SELinux и AppArmor — это программы, которые могут ограничивать доступ к файлам и ресурсам на системе. Убедитесь, что правила этих программ не блокируют доступ к файлам или директориям, с которыми вы работаете.

5. Проверьте наличие необходимых пакетов и зависимостей

Если при выполнении операции возникает ошибка eperm, убедитесь, что у вас установлены все необходимые пакеты и зависимости. Некоторые программы или команды могут требовать наличия определенных пакетов для выполнения определенных операций.

6. Обратитесь за помощью к администратору системы

Если вы все еще не можете решить проблему с ошибкой eperm, рекомендуется обратиться за помощью к администратору системы. Он сможет помочь вам определить возможные причины ошибки и предложить соответствующие решения.

Рейтинг
( Пока оценок нет )
Загрузка ...